Responsibilities

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

Leave Management Responsibilities

  • Manage programs like the FMLA, ADA, STD, and LTD and other company-specific leave policies.
  • Ensure compliance with relevant laws and regulations, manage leave requests and approvals, and maintain accurate records.
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for employees and managers regarding leave-related matters, providing guidance and support throughout the leave process.
  • Engage with third-party leave administrators to ensure smooth and efficient leave management.
  • Maintain accurate records of leave and accommodation requests, ensuring compliance with company policies and legal requirements, and conducting periodic audits.

Recruiting Responsibilities

  • Reviews and discusses approved Personnel Requisitions and job description with hiring manager to determine the jobs specific requirements, interview team, discuss timeline, potential compensation, etc. Continually updates the requisition log. Ensures compliance with federal and state recruiting regulations.
  • Identifies applicant sources, prepares job posting materials, and drafts advertisements. Sources resumes and screens against minimum qualifications. May telephone screen qualified applicants for knowledge, skills, abilities, and/or salary requirements.
  • Forwards and discusses qualified applicant resumes with hiring manager in order to determine applicants to be interviewed.
  • Schedules candidate interviews with hiring manager and interview team. Provides guidance on appropriate and non-appropriate questions, provides sample interview questions, and may arrange for mock interviews to build managers interview skills.
  • Conducts post-interview feedback sessions or obtains candidate assessment from interview team.
  • Extends verbal job offer to select candidate. Coordinates the offer package preparation; obtains the appropriate approvals.
  • Upon written acceptance and completed forms, initiates background investigations and license verification as required. Investigates and resolves background/employment related issues. Escalates issues that conflict with hiring practices.

Generalist Responsibilities

  • Administers Leave of Absences in accordance with current regulations, policies, and procedures.
  • Provides consultation to employees and management on human resource management issues to include staffing; employee relations; sexual harassment; performance management; dispute resolution; compliance and integrity; policy administration; and disseminating and providing guidance on company policies and procedures in compliance with applicable state and federal laws.
  • May conduct investigates employee relation issues; identifies issues, facts, policy violations, and other culture/values that impact the workplace; and recommends solutions and how to obtain resolution. May involve HR technical experts to troubleshoot and resolves issues.
  • Conducts exit interviews, summarizes findings, and writes executive overview. Manages employee engagement survey, summarizes findings, and facilitates follow-up and action items meetings. May perform work force analysis and recommendations on a variety of HR issues.

Conducts employee training on a variety of Human Resources topics. May develop training materials.
